The administration named Shaukat Tarin as the head of a subcommittee of the Economic Coordination Committee (ECC) on Thursday to guarantee he remained part of the decision-making process, despite a court ruling prohibiting unelected lawmakers from heading cabinet committees.
According to a statement published by the Cabinet Division, Prime Minister Imran Khan reorganised the cabinet’s ECC and appointed Economic Affairs Minister Omar Ayub as its chairman in place of Tarin.
